![]() |
|
|
Google unix.com
|
|||||||
| Форумы | Регистрация | Правила форума | Ссылки | Альбомы | ЧАВО | Список участников | Календарь | Поиск | Сегодняшние сообщения | Отметить форумы читать |
| Shell программирование и сценарии Почтовые вопросы о KSH, CSH, SH, BASH, Perl, PHP, SED, AWK и скрипты оболочки и оболочки скриптовых языков здесь. |
Подробнее UNIX и Linux Темы форума можно найти полезные
|
||||
| Нить | Резьба для начинающих | Форум | Ответы | Последнее сообщение |
| Замена Пространства | Amey Джосхи | UNIX для чайников Вопросы И Ответы | 3 | 11-11-2008 11:15 PM |
| Нужна помощь в замене пространств в файл | САИС | Shell программирование и сценарии | 7 | 10-06-2008 10:24 AM |
| Замена символа в файле с нулевой стоимостью | HLee1981 | Shell программирование и сценарии | 18 | 07-18-2006 02:33 PM |
| Обработка нулевых входных ... | DrRo183 | Shell программирование и сценарии | 2 | 04-11-2006 02:32 AM |
| И найти замену пустых строк помещений в файл | Gerry405 | SUN Solaris | 2 | 07-21-2005 05:49 AM |
![]() |
|
|
LinkBack | Резьба Инструменты | Искать в этом Thread | Оценить Thread | Режимы дисплея |
|
|
|
||||
|
заменить пространств с нулевой или 0 в файл ввода
привет
У меня отчеты в моей входной файл, как этот AAA | 1234 | | 2bc | | rahul | Тамилнаду BBA | 2234 | | b4c | | bajaj | Тамилнаду то, чем я ожидал это в период между двумя трубами, если нет характера он должен быть заменен или недействительными 0 Так что мой файл будет выглядеть так AAA | 1234 | нулевой | 2bc | 0 | rahul | Тамилнаду BBA | 2234 | нулевой | b4c | 0 | bajaj | Тамилнаду Как это сделать Может ли кто-нибудь объяснить заранее спасибо |
|
||||
|
Спасибо большое она работала
но я хотел недействительным и 0 для густонаселенных Есть ли путь за одно и то же заранее спасибо |
|
||||
|
Код:
#! /usr/bin/perl
open FH,"<a.txt";
while(<FH>){
my @tmp=split("[|]",$_);
map{$_=$_||"null"} @tmp;
print join "|",@tmp;
}
|
![]() |
| Закладки |
| Резьба Инструменты | Искать в этом Thread |
| Режимы дисплея | Оценить эту ветку |
|
|